A foundation member of the All Progressives Congress, APC, Mr Osita Okechukwu has lauded ex-president Muhammadu Buhari for standing with the masses in all his policies.

This is coming at a time the World Bank is advising the Federal Government to increase the pump price of petrol to as much as N750/litre.

DAILY POST reported that the Labour Party, LP, the Peoples Democratic Party, PDP, and the Nigeria Labour Congress, NLC, have all warned the Nigerian Government against heeding the advice of the World Bank.https://dailypost.ng/2023/12/18/fuel-price-nlc-pdp-lp-issue-kick-as-world-bank-recommends-n750-litre/

In a statement to felicitate with the ex-president as he clocked 81 years, Okechukwu, who spoke under the aegis of the Buharists, said he (Buhari) resisted World Bank’s anti-people policies.

He extolled the ex-leader’s sterling qualities, especially “his pro-people agenda and his Spartan lifestyle.”

Okechukwu, a notable Buharist and former Director General of Voice of Nigeria (DG, VON), recalled how Buhari devoted his public service to the common man.

He said Buhari raised a marshal plan to confront the challenge of food security in the country, regretting that insurgency slowed down the drive to make Nigeria food sufficient.

He said: “this is the appropriate time to recount his pro-people policies, his resistance to the World Bank’s anti-people policies, even as military Head of State.

“Billions of naira in bail-out funds were granted to state governments, social investment programmes, reduction of infrastructural deficit and the famous Buhari’s unprecedented agrarian revolution to enhance Nigerians prosperity.

“We, the Buharists, make bold to state that because of his passion for food security he invested more than any other federal government in agriculture post 1970.

“Regrettably, we lament the truism that palpable insecurity diminished his quest for food security as his credo was- we must produce what we eat.”

The Buharists appealed to President Bola Ahmed Tinubu to continue with some of the laudable programmes, “particularly Buhari’s Agrarian Revolution like the Green Imperative Program designed to mechanise agriculture nationwide and Anchor Borrowers Programme,” under whatever nomenclature.

“We are happy that President Tinubu promised to continue with our icon’s initiatives, because that is a befitting way to honour the image of this great Nigerian who loves the poor and cares for the nation,” Okechukwu stated.
